Due to internal progression, we have an exciting opportunity for a passionate **Assistant EHCP Officer** to join our dedicated SEND & ALS Department.

They will support operational aspects of the Education Health and Care process including the chairing of annual reviews of EHC plans for college students, and supporting the transition of pupils with EHC plans into college by liaising with schools and attending review meetings where appropriate.

This is a key role in supporting the college in the implementation of the SEN Code of Practice and ensuring the college meets its legal and statutory requirements for SEND students.

**Responsibilities include**:

- Chairing annual review meetings of college students with EHC Plans, working under the direction of the college EHC Plan Lead Officer;
- Ensuring that meetings are effectively recorded and all updates and changes are accurately reflected in paperwork sent to the local authority;
- Supporting the processes that mean timely responses to consultations on placement of young people with EHC plans can be made;
- Attending annual reviews of pupils in years 9 and above to support improved transition for young people with EHC Plans;
- Seeking feedback and holds focus groups with students with EHC plans in order to continually and effectively improve our services;
- Supporting the preparing for adulthood agenda by promoting an aspirational culture in terms of life after college, including further learning, vocational training, employment or independent living, in line with desired EHC Plan outcomes;
- Offering self-help strategies and information, referring to appropriate agencies and liaising with College staff as necessary.
- Providing training to teaching and support staff working with students with a range of additional needs.
- Maintaining accurate records that support the college in all its quality assurance/audit processes and funding claims in line with institutional responsibilities and departmental expectations.
